Soft reset
A soft reset restarts the PDA phone but does not erase any data, program, or system settings.
To p e rfo r m a s oft r e se t :
1. Locate the recessed Reset at the bottom of the phone.
2. Insert the stylus into the recess to trigger
Reset. Hold Reset down until the screen fades off.
3. Release the stylus from the Reset button to restart the phone.
Hard reset
Same as soft reset, a hard reset restarts the PDA phone without erasing any data, program, or
system settings. But, a hard reset also resets the system time to the default value (1 January,
2006).
To p e rfo r m a hard rese t :
1. Locate the recessed Reset at the bottom of the phone.
2. Press and hold down
Power.
3. Without releasing
Power, insert the stylus into the recess to trigger Reset. Hold down both
Power and Reset until the screen fades off.
4. When the screen has faded off completely, release both
Power and the stylus.
Clean boot
A clean boot restarts the PDA phone by erasing all data, programs as well as system settings,
and thus returns to its factory default state.
To p e rfo r m a cle a n res e t :
1. Locate the recessed Reset at the bottom of the PDA phone.
2. Press and hold down
Power.
3. Without releasing
Power, insert the stylus into the recess to trigger Reset. Hold down both
Power and Reset until the screen fades off.
4. When the screen has faded off completely, release both
Power and the stylus.
